USB persistente com guias de mais de 4Gig não funciona?

USB persistente com guias de mais de 4Gig não funciona?

Ok, eu sei que isso foi perguntado mais de uma vez no fórum e li e experimentei os dois guias que encontrei e mais um no Pen-Drive. Eu também preferiria ter comentado as postagens que encontrei, mas não posso comentar até ter 50 pontos de representação, mas posso editar a postagem original que estou tentando comentar, não faz sentido, mas legal, é assim que o fórum funciona .

Os três guias que encontrei são:

Como fazer um Ubuntu USB persistente ao vivo com mais de 4 GB

Problemas com persistência depois de criar um pen drive USB usando Pendrivelinux

Crie uma partição Casper maior que 4 GB

O problema que estou tendo é que nenhum deles parece funcionar, eu tentei com Ubuntu e Kubuntu 16, 12 e 11, já que o único comentário no primeiro link também disse que não consegue fazê-lo funcionar em nada acima de 14.

O problema que tenho é que acabo com a tela da morte Illegal OpCode Red, a instalação não detecta a persistência e pede para tentar ou instalar o Linux cada vez que ele inicializa, não consigo montar /dev/sda2 em /cow, ou recebo uma tela preta dizendo initramfs.

Eu tentei quase todas as correções que encontrei nos comentários dos tópicos com base nos erros.

Eu tentei o Universal-USB-Installer, o live-usb-installer, o linuxlive usb creator, há cerca de um mês, um programa chamado rufus ou algo assim.

Todos os guias e aplicativos funcionam até chegar à parte em que excluo o arquivo casper-rw

Até me deparei com este post:Não é possível inicializar o Ubuntu Live USB Flash Drive com partição persistente casper-rwtentei todos os passos que o usuário deu nos comentários (araghuteja) e depois de deletar o arquivo casper-rw recebo o initramfs da tela traseira novamente.

Atualmente estou tentando o comentário de Yu Jia Cheong, mas estou preso na etapa 3 e no comentário dela:

3) Inicialize com o novo USB. Abra /usr/share/initramfs-tools/scripts/casper com root para editar (sudo). Altere a função setup_unionfs() para o seguinte: https://launchpadlibrarian.net/258626969/casper%20function.txt

4) sudo update-initramfs -u (tive que desinstalar o cryptsetup para fazer isso)

5) Copie o arquivo initrd.img gerado de /boot para outro local.

6) De outro sistema operacional, exclua o arquivo casper-rw do USB. Copie o initrd.img de volta para a partição ativa e altere o item de menu para usar o initrd.img recém-criado.

Na próxima vez que você inicializar a partir do USB, ele deverá inicializar a partir da partição casper-rw.

Isso funcionou para mim em 16.04, depois de um longo tempo frustrante procurando a solução!

Não sei se estou muito cansado de ler neste momento e meus olhos estão lendo o que quero ler e não o que está escrito, mas o arquivo mencionado me parece igual àquele para o qual o link aponta.

E se eu executar a etapa 4 depois de fechar o arquivo, recebo uma mensagem de erro...

Alguém tem alguma ideia de onde estou bagunçando isso?

Obrigada pelo tempo...

Responder1

Partições persistentes não funcionam com o Ubuntu, instalações do tipo syslinux desde 14.04.

Estes incluem Rufus, UNetbootin, Universal, Startup Disk Creator, etc.

Partições persistentes funcionam com instalações do tipo grub2 e podem ser criadas automaticamente com mkusb e dus, ambos criados pelo Sudodus.

As informações mais recentes sobre esses instaladores podem ser encontradas em:

https://help.ubuntu.com/community/mkusb

Responder2

Atualização agosto/2017

Syslinux começou a adicionar suporte para NTFS com a versão 4.06, mas não ofereceu suporte completo até a versão 6.03.

UNetbootin - 655 usa Syslinux 4.03 e ainda está limitado a arquivos de persistência de 4 GB por FAT32.

MultiBootUSB - 8.8 usa Syslinux 4.07 e será instalado em NTFS, os arquivos de persistência não estão limitados a 4 GB.

Rufus 2.16 usa Syslinux 6.03 e será instalado em NTFS. Arquivos de persistência não são fornecidos, mas podem ser adicionados manualmente e não estão limitados a 4 GB.

YUMI - 2.0.4.9, (MultiBoot USB), usa Syslinux 6.03 e será instalado em NTFS, os arquivos de persistência não estão limitados a 4GB. Assim como o MBUSB 8.8, ele pode ter arquivos de persistência para cada instalação de distro

Responder3

Acho que o problema está aqui:

4) sudo update-initramfs -u (tive que desinstalar o cryptsetup para fazer isso)

Você está fazendo isso com umcriptografadosistema.

-o-

Em um sistema live padrão você pode simplesmente substituir o arquivo casper-rw por uma partição casper-rw e o sistema live o encontrará.

  • Inicialização a partiroutrounidade ao vivo

  • Remova o arquivo casper-rw.

  • Começargparted

  • Reduza a partição onde você tem o sistema (e onde você tinha o arquivo casper-rw).

  • Use o espaço em disco não alocado para criar uma nova partição com um sistema de arquivos ext (ext2, ext3 ou ext4).

  • Coloque orótulo casper-rwnesta nova partição.

  • Clique na marca para realmente realizar as alterações.

  • Reinicie (e certifique-se de que haja uma opção de inicialização 'persistente').

-o-

Você pode fazer tudo isso automaticamente commkusbe crie um novo usuário com home criptografado posteriormente.

informação relacionada